Tb2InAu2 is an intermetallic compound composed of terbium, indium, and gold, belonging to the rare-earth metal alloy family. This is a research-stage material studied primarily for its electronic and magnetic properties rather than bulk structural applications. The material is of interest in condensed matter physics and materials science research, particularly for investigating rare-earth intermetallic phases and their potential use in advanced electronic devices, magnetic systems, or functional materials where the combination of rare-earth and noble metal elements may offer unusual electronic behavior or magnetic coupling.
